What is Verizon Cloud?

Verizon Cloud is an integrated storage platform, which enables businesses to create backups and share files securely from different devices such as PCs or mobile phones. The multi-tenant storage platform allows users to encrypt files with passwords and protect them from viruses, system crashes, and accidental data losses.

The application lets employees schedule the automatic backup of selected files or folders and send links to clients or team members for downloading documents. Users can synchronize contacts, photos, videos, audio, call logs, text messages, and documents using Verizon Cloud’s storage system. With the iOS and Android mobile applications, individuals can sort files and create private folders with PIN protection to save them.

It lets employees run backup processes in the background manually or automatically, change folders and settings, and view the backup progress. Team members can also view details of previous backup activities such as the number of images, videos or music files uploaded along with reports.
